What Is a Plus Size Lingerie Model?

A plus size lingerie model is a professional model who represents lingerie brands in sizes 14 and above (typically L–4X, depending on the brand).
They showcase:

  • how lingerie fits on curvier bodies
  • how design, fabric, and structure adapt to fuller shapes
  • how real bodies look without extreme retouching
  • body-positive and inclusive styling

Unlike traditional fashion models—often photographed in sample sizes—plus size lingerie models provide accurate fit expectations for customers with curves.

How to Choose Flattering Lingerie for Your Body

Finding pieces that make you feel incredible comes down to understanding fit, fabric, and personal preference.

Size & Fit Considerations

Most brands now offer extended sizing, but measurements matter more than labels. Check bust, waist, hip, and torso length against size charts. Look for adjustable straps and hook-and-eye closures with multiple settings.

Material Matters

Lace sits gently on skin without digging in, making it ideal for curves. Seamless fabrics create smooth lines under clothing. Look for cotton-lined gussets for comfort and breathability. Quality materials from trusted retailers like Jissbon ensure durability and comfort.

Support & Structure

Underwire or soft-cup bras depend on your preference. Balconette styles lift and separate. Babydolls flow over the midsection. Teddies with snap closures offer convenience.

Details That Enhance

Strategic cutouts draw the eye where you want it. Ruching camouflages areas you're less confident about. High-waisted bottoms smooth the stomach. Garters add flair without requiring confidence in every area.

Plus Size Lingerie vs. Standard Sizing: What's Different

Many people wonder how plus size lingerie differs beyond just larger measurements.

Aspect

Standard Sizing

Plus Size Approach

Cup Design

Often shallow, wide-set

Deeper cups, closer-set for natural breast position

Band Width

Narrow elastic

Wider bands distribute weight comfortably

Strap Placement

Closer to neck

Positioned to prevent shoulder digging

Fabric Stretch

Moderate give

Enhanced stretch zones at key stress points

Seam Construction

Basic finishing

Reinforced at high-tension areas

When to Pick Plus Size Specific Designs: Choose these when you need genuine support and proportional construction. Regular lingerie sized up often gaps or binds awkwardly because it's not engineered for curves.

When Standard Extended Sizes Work: Simple sleep sets, robes, or loose babydolls without structure requirements can work fine in straight-sized brands' larger options.

Fabric & Skin Compatibility Basics

Different materials suit different needs and sensitivities.

Lace Options: Nylon/spandex lace stretches and breathes. Cotton lace works for sensitive skin but offers less give. Avoid rigid lace with rough edges.

Smooth Fabrics: Microfiber creates invisible lines under clothes. Satin feels luxurious but can be slippery. Modal blends offer softness with structure.

Natural Fibers: Cotton provides breathability for everyday wear. Silk regulates temperature naturally but requires delicate care.

Compatibility Notes: If you have latex sensitivity, check for elastic alternatives. Care & Maintenance for Delicate Pieces

Proper care extends the life of quality lingerie significantly.

Before First Wear: Hand wash in cool water with mild detergent. This removes manufacturing residues and softens fabrics. Air dry completely.

After Each Use: Rinse immediately if needed, especially if combined with intimate activities. Hand wash or use a mesh bag on delicate cycle. Never use fabric softener—it breaks down elastic.

Drying & Storage: Lay flat or hang by the center gore (never by straps). Store in a drawer where cups won't crush. Keep away from direct sunlight which fades colors.

Material-Specific Cautions: Sequins and hardware can snag on other items—store separately. Underwire pieces need reshaping after washing. Leather/faux leather requires specialized cleaners.

Representation in Media: Why It Matters

The presence of plus size lingerie models in advertising, social media, and fashion campaigns creates tangible benefits.

Psychological Impact: Studies on body image and media representation show that seeing diverse body types reduces anxiety about appearance and increases self-acceptance. When major brands feature models size 14-24, it signals that beauty exists across the size spectrum.

Market Response: Consumer demand for inclusive sizing has grown exponentially. Brands that embrace representation often see increased loyalty and sales because customers feel seen and valued.

Cultural Shift: Prominent plus size models like Ashley Graham, Tess Holliday, and Paloma Elsesser have amassed millions of followers, proving that audiences crave authentic representation over airbrushed uniformity.

Common Questions & Quick Troubleshooting

Finding the Right Size When Brands Vary: Sister sizing helps bridge gaps. If a 38D feels too tight in the band, try 40C (same cup volume, looser band). Always check individual brand size charts—vanity sizing is inconsistent.

Managing Discomfort from Underwires: Underwires should sit flat against your ribcage, never on breast tissue. If they poke, the cup is too small or the band too loose. Try wire-free options with structured cups for support without metal.

Dealing with Chafing or Irritation: Seams and elastic cause most friction issues. Apply anti-chafe balm preventatively. Choose seamless construction or flat-lock seams. Ensure pieces aren't too tight—you should fit two fingers under bands comfortably.

How do I know if lingerie actually fits correctly?

Bands should sit level around your torso without riding up. Cups should fully contain breast tissue with no spillage or gaping. Straps stay in place without constant adjustment but don't dig into shoulders. You can move, breathe, and sit comfortably without constant tugging or repositioning.
